Towlie Mcheadscarf

What is Towlie Mcheadscarf?


1.

A description/insult of someone from the middle-east. Towlie McHeadscarf describes the person by the headdress they wear.

1) "Did you see that Towlie waving an AK47 next to a picture of a dead relative?"

2) "Oh no, Towlies on the news again!"

See Troll


40

Random Words:

1. The belief in Ryne's Theory "Whats your take on Rynism?" "I agree 100%, therefore Im a Rynist" See theory, t..
1. spanish (mexico) combination of 'que' (what) and 'hubo' (verb 'haber' was) to mean 'what's up&ap..
1. a small dog such as a chihuahua that is often carried around in a purse or handbag by celebrities like Paris Hilton In the movie "..